## Deployment

As of release 3.2, all scheduled tasks formerly run via cron on the Tolloway hosts are executed by the Driftline workflow engine. Each legacy crontab entry maps to a named workflow; the mapping table lives in this repository under `workflows/`. Before deploying, confirm the scheduler picks up the configuration values reproduced below.

config for yawep-tajef:
[kelion]
team = kelys
access_code = ac_1a130d
owner = holax.aldmir
host = kelion.urlaqforge.example
port = 9090
peer = fenmir.lumicio.example
salt = d0dd3cb5
pin = 3295

Internal Memo — Sales Leads, Marrowgate Components

Procurement has begun a structured search for a second-source supplier of the actuator housings used in the Larkfield series. Candidate vendors in three regions are being evaluated on capacity, quality certification, and lead time. Please avoid committing customers to expedited delivery until qualification concludes. Pricing effects should be modest. The commercial reasoning behind this move is recorded in the confidential note below.

management briefing: The renewal with Zoraelax Group closes at $10 million a year, 15 percent below the last contract. Project Ralael slips by six weeks because of the audit delay.

Subject: Handover — Spoolhaven release duties

Dear reviewer,

As agreed, I am documenting the handover of the Spoolhaven printer-spooler microservice releases to Anders. All artifacts are built reproducibly, signed at the packaging stage, and verified again at deploy time. Access to the signing material is restricted to the release role; rotation occurs quarterly and is logged. For completeness of this review, the currently active signing key is recorded below.

signing key of bagap-yawep = bky13_TbfT6ZMUoGJo2

## Bike Cage & Parking Gates — Quorrell Point

The bike cage sits to the left of the main parking gates and is accessible from 06:00 to 23:00 daily. Reception staff should remind visitors that the vehicle gates open via badge only, whereas the bike cage keypad accepts a shared code. For cyclists requesting entry, provide the code below.

door code, hawip-fadup: bdg-ALUHZ-17265